The first thing you need to consider is how often you plan on using the stand mixer. If you plan on using your mixer for more than once every week, you should consider buying a mixer with an electric motor made from metal gears. A majority of mixers today use plastic gears and can't withstand high use. It is more expensive to purchase the stand mixer with metal gears, but you'll end up buying a device that will last for a long time.

Another thing to think about is how much mixing power is available to the stand mixer. A lot of people make the mistake of putting wattage in relation to power. In reality, more wattage doesn't affect the fact that the mixer will be more powerful , although it may be less powerful than Watts. One of the best ways to evaluate the power of a mixer is to determine the amount of flour that it can accommodate as well as the weight of the dough it's able to mix. If you're planning to use your machine to mix heavy dough, then it is essential to find a mixer with enough strength to complete the tasks.
